Serena Williams has accepted wild card invitations to compete in both the singles and doubles events at Wimbledon. She played two doubles warmup matches before receiving the invitations. Williams trained at the practice courts at The All England Lawn Tennis and Croquet Club on June 24, 2026. She commented half-jokingly that 'it’s summer' and 'the kids aren’t in school' as reasons for her return to professional tennis after four years away. According to nbcsports.com, Williams has two daughters, eight-year-old Olympia and Adira, who is almost three. According to bangkokpost, Serena Williams said a comment from her daughter inspired her decision to return to play doubles at Wimbledon alongside sister Venus later in June. On X, Williams wrote: 'Just finished a mean game of duck duck goose.' Family is described as possibly the biggest factor in Serena Williams’ return to professional tennis after four years away.
